Transaction 6860a16810effb0caa4f4a98f51166d026a44e47cf621be665f2d99f77252f4a

11 Input
2 Outputs
  • 6860a16810effb0caa4f4a98f51166d026a44e47cf621be665f2d99f77252f4a:0
  • value  62953253
    address  1JN2xyspUCTPjxTPTvf3cbsDKMfkMdWtnj
  • 6860a16810effb0caa4f4a98f51166d026a44e47cf621be665f2d99f77252f4a:1
  • value  71346765
    address  3ArKyrezMUNZgjuh3HpW8wHUpmHYjPTtD4